The guidance details the creation of a CodeSystem resource within a FHIR server. This resource must be assigned a unique URI, preferably a URL, for proper identification.

A high-severity vulnerability, CVE-2025-27820, was detected in the httpclient5-5.4.1.jar library. This vulnerability affects FHIR implementations that utilize this specific library version.

The topic covered the deployment options for SMART on FHIR applications. Specifically, it addressed the decision point of whether the application should run as a standalone interface or be integrated directly into an Electronic Health Record (EHR).
